University of Fribourg– Highlights

The University of Fribourg, established in 1889, is renowned for its exceptional academic standards and diverse research opportunities. Situated in the heart of Switzerland, it boasts a unique bilingual environment offering courses in both French and German. The university prides itself on its modern infrastructure, state-of-the-art facilities, and a vibrant campus life that fosters intellectual and cultural exchange. With a strong emphasis on research, the university attracts leading scholars and experts from around the world, ensuring a high-quality education for its students.

  • Year of Establishment: 1889
  • QS Ranking: 471-480 (2023)
  • Other Rankings:
    1. Times Higher Education Ranking: 401-500
    2. Academic Ranking of World Universities (ARWU): 601-700
    3. U-Multirank: Top 25 Performing Universities in International Orientation
    4. Leiden Ranking: Top 500
    5. Webometrics Ranking: 566
  • Infrastructure: Modern libraries, research labs, sports facilities, and student residences
  • Teaching Faculty: Highly experienced and internationally recognized experts
  • Funding: Supported by government grants, private donations, and research grants
  • Accreditation: Swiss Accreditation Council

Cost of Tuition Fees

The tuition fees at the University of Fribourg are relatively affordable compared to other European universities. The approximate tuition fees for undergraduate and postgraduate programs are as follows:

Program Approximate Fees (CHF)
Undergraduate 1,500 - 2,000 per year
Postgraduate 1,600 - 2,200 per year

Cost of Living

The cost of living in Fribourg is relatively moderate, with the following approximate expenses:

Expense Approximate Cost (CHF)
Rent, travel utility 800 - 1,200 per month
Food & Drink, entertainment 400 - 600 per month
